PURPOSE:To obtain the titled steel bar having high toughness as cooled in the air after hot forging without carrying out quenching followed by tempering by providing a specified composition consisting of C, Si, Mn, Cr, Al and Fe. CONSTITUTION:This unnormalized steel bar for hot forging consists of, by weight, 0.05-0.15% C, 0.10-1.00% Si, 0.60-3.00% Mn, 2.20-5.90% Cr+Mn, 0.01-0.05% Al and the balance essentially Fe. The steel has necessary strength and high toughness such as about 70-90kg/mm.<2> tensile strength and >= about 5kg-m/cm<2> impact value as cooled in the air after hot forging. Among said alloying components, C is required to attain said strength, yet >0.15% C makes the strength excessively high and reduces the toughness. >1.00% Si makes the strength excessively high. Mn is required to control the strength and toughness, yet >3.00% Mn deteriorates the machinability. Cr is required to attain said strength and toughness in combination with Mn, and Al is a necessary element acting as a deoxidizer.
